Osborne 1995, a lovely mature brick red colour, 60% opaque. Glorious nose of redcurrant with just a tiny hint of VA that adds to the complexity and doesn’t overwhelm fruit. Attractive mature fruit in the mid-weight palate, sweet and ripe with a slight dusting of tannins. Nicely mature with a lovely level of acidity, the style of Port I enjoy drinking at home by the fire. 90/100.
